We are seeking workshop proposals for the upcoming 15th Annual Community Empowerment Through Black Men Healing Conference held on June 22 & 23, 2023, at Metropolitan State University St. Paul Campus. On June 25th, 2009, a conference entitled "Community Empowerment Through Black Men Healing" brought together professionals, community practitioners, men and women, and anyone interested in addressing the question, "Could a focus on black men's healing be a way to empower the community?" In this 15th year of the conference, we will reexamine that question and explore practical trauma-informed, culture-sensitive outcome-driven current and future approaches that can lead to community empowerment and healing.
Since its inception in 2009, the mission of the conference has provided an opportunity for meaningful community engagement and access to national and local educators, and community practitioners to discuss and introduce practical culturally sensitive trauma informed initiatives leading to the improved health and wellness of African American men and their families. We realize that a stronger, thriving African American community improves the health of the community and the society as a whole.
